AE - The First 48 Bail Out Seeing Red environmental But it's Klaus Kinski whoIn Dallas, Detectives Scott Sayers and Ken Penrod are investigating a home invasion that left a young man dead. Is their suspect just a young suburban mom, or a criminal mastermind? And in Cincinnati, a brutal stabbing ends the life of a hard working grandfather. After interviewing a series of family members, Det. Jenny Luke finds out that her suspect may be closer than she initially thought.
